# K-Food Town

> Market offers authentic Korean products including fresh banchans, homemade kimchi, and purple sweet potatoes. Space feels clean and well-organized with a varied selection of snacks, skincare, and groceries. Visitors find it affordable and enjoy discovering unique items not found in regular stores.

## Good to know

- K-Food Town offers unique Korean products not found in regular markets.
- Prices at K-Food Town are affordable for most visitors.
- They carry a variety of items including snacks, cosmetics, and fresh juices.
- The store is clean and well-organized, making shopping easy.
- K-Food Town frequently updates its inventory with new items.
